From 19bb0a5d5273f08aff62c64bb3513408d0f8c62c Mon Sep 17 00:00:00 2001 From: wmayer Date: Tue, 28 Jan 2025 14:14:32 +0100 Subject: [PATCH] Test: Add test case for UnitsSchemaMeterDecimal --- tests/src/Base/SchemaTests.cpp |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/tests/src/Base/SchemaTests.cpp b/tests/src/Base/SchemaTests.cpp index 412bc8ac81..1c36444e2a 100644 --- a/tests/src/Base/SchemaTests.cpp +++ b/tests/src/Base/SchemaTests.cpp @@ -76,6 +76,14 @@ protected: std::unique_ptr schemas; // NOLINT }; +TEST_F(SchemaTest, meter_decimal_1_mm_precision_6) +{ + const std::string result = setWithPrecision("MeterDecimal", 1.0, Unit::Length, 6); + const auto expect {"0.001000 m"}; + + EXPECT_EQ(result, expect); +} + TEST_F(SchemaTest, imperial_decimal_1_mm_default_precision) { const std::string result = set("ImperialDecimal", Unit::Length, 1.0);